Responsibilities
- Understanding and interpreting construction plans and blueprints to determine project specifications.
- Accurately measuring and marking materials to ensure precise cuts and placements.
- Using a variety of hand and power tools to cut and shape materials, such as wood, metal, and plastic.
- Assembling and joining materials to construct structures or frameworks, ensuring everything fits together securely.
- Installing structures and fixtures, including doors, windows, cabinets, and moulding.
- Repairing or replacing damaged or worn parts of existing structures or furniture.
- Designing, constructing, and installing cabinets, cupboards, and other storage solutions.
- Building and installing frameworks, including walls, floors, and roofs, as well as structural components like beams and columns.
- Keeping tools and equipment in good working condition through regular maintenance.
- Collaborating with other construction professionals, such as architects, builders, and other trades, to ensure project coherence.
- Identifying and solving construction challenges, such as uneven surfaces or structural issues.
- Adhering to safety regulations and guidelines to maintain a secure working environment.
- Managing time efficiently to meet project deadlines and budgets.
- Staying updated on new construction techniques, materials, and tools through training and professional development.
- Applying finishes to wood surfaces, such as staining or painting, enhances aesthetics and protects against wear.
